At AMN Healthcare, we have successfully placed 18 Interventional Radiology RNs in high-paying Travel jobs across Kentucky, helping professionals like you find rewarding opportunities in top healthcare facilities. These recently filled positions offered weekly pay ranging from $1,825 to $2,518, with an average of $2,098 per week. Job placements spanned multiple cities around Kentucky including Louisville, Georgetown, and Madisonville ensuring flexibility and a variety of work environments.
Our previously filled roles were at respected healthcare institutions such as UofL Health – University of Louisville Hospital, demonstrating the wide range of opportunities available for skilled professionals like you. As a Registered Nurse specializing in Interventional Radiology in Kentucky, you can expect to engage in a diverse range of clinical environments, primarily within hospitals that feature advanced imaging and procedural capabilities. Facilities such as academic medical centers, community hospitals, and outpatient surgical centers will seek your expertise in assisting with minimally invasive procedures, employing imaging technologies like fluoroscopy, CT, and ultrasound. Your role will involve collaborating with interdisciplinary teams, preparing patients for procedures, monitoring their recovery, and ensuring compliance with safety protocols. In Louisville, the weekly earnings for Interventional Radiology positions range from $1,825 to $2,455.
